About this event

Explore the intersection of history, art, and grassroots activism with New York City AIDS Memorial Executive Director Dave Harper. This immersive program begins with a guided walking tour of the New York City AIDS Memorial—including its newest site-specific installation, Eternal Flame for Scott Burton by artist Oscar Tuazon—as well as its historic environs, like the LGBT Community Center and the former St. Vincent’s Hospital. This portion of the tour seeks to ground visitors in the West Village neighborhood that served as the poignant epicenter of the epidemic, allowing you to trace the footsteps of advocates, caretakers, and activists who changed the course of history. This journey culminates in a visit to the exhibition Love & Fury: New York’s Fight Against AIDS, curated by Ian Bradley-Perrin at Poster House.
